Professional Music Rehearsal Use
For music clients, the facility operates as a dedicated rehearsal environment for professional, full-volume use.
Tour rehearsals require predictable conditions, sufficient space, and separation from unrelated activity. Soundstage Studios has supported professional rehearsals for over 25 years, accommodating projects ranging from short preparation periods to extended rehearsal schedules.
While no urban building can eliminate all external sound under every possible condition, the rehearsal environment provides high levels of sound isolation suitable for uninterrupted work in real-world London conditions. In practice, external noise has not proven disruptive to sessions.
Film, Video & Content Production
Film, video, and content production clients work within a booked production environment prepared for controlled shooting requirements. This includes support for green screen, white infinity cove, blackout production, and multi-camera setups.
Each booking is treated as exclusive use for its intended purpose. The environment is prepared for the specific requirements of the project in advance and remains consistent throughout the booking, allowing lighting, camera, and crew workflows to continue uninterrupted across single or multiple shoot days.
Support Spaces, Technical Services & Production Resources
While the core studio environment remains fixed for the booking, surrounding support areas can be arranged to support the operational structure of a project alongside the main working space.
Where required, productions have access to a broad range of in-house technical services and production resources to support complex or specialist requirements. These include:
- In-house technical expertise through the Synthesiser Service Centre, with over 40 years’ experience
- Equipment and backline rental via Studiohire.net, offering an extensive and eclectic inventory spanning orchestral and specialist percussion, keyboards and electronic instruments, and a wide range of musical and production equipment
- Secure overnight storage accommodation
- Engineering and fabrication facilities, including welding, lathes, hoists, and heavy-duty jacking
- Comprehensive lighting, backline, PA systems, amplification, audio monitoring, video monitors, video mixers, and extensive cabling
These resources are available to support the technical and logistical demands of a project without affecting the booked working environment.
